Output 63c12c69803fc778a04341de45ddf781c81cd39f3ef79035e8df5994e537e100:1

value
6960228902108
script pubkey
OP_0 OP_PUSHBYTES_20 1fe82ba32afde0156bed53eb940835d9554d1f74
address
tb1qrl5zhge2lhsp26ld204egzp4m92568m5p2qxsp
transaction
63c12c69803fc778a04341de45ddf781c81cd39f3ef79035e8df5994e537e100
confirmations
173219
spent
true